The Science Behind RO Purification
The core mechanism of what is RO in water purifier systems revolves around osmotic pressure. In nature, water naturally moves through a membrane from a less concentrated solution to a more concentrated one to achieve balance. Reverse Osmosis inverts this natural process by applying external pressure to the contaminated water, forcing it to move against the concentration gradient.
This action allows only pure water molecules to pass through the microscopic pores of the membrane, leaving behind a vast array of pollutants. The rejected contaminants are safely flushed away, resulting in water that is significantly purer than the input source. This scientific principle is what allows RO systems to tackle complex water quality issues that simpler methods cannot resolve.
Key Contaminants Removed by RO Systems
When evaluating what is RO in water purifier capabilities, its effectiveness against specific contaminants is a primary consideration. These systems are renowned for their ability to remove up to 99% of dissolved solids, making them highly effective for specific water quality challenges.
Heavy metals such as lead, arsenic, mercury, and cadmium
Dissolved salts and total dissolved solids (TDS)
Bacteria, viruses, and various pathogens
Chemical contaminants like pesticides and herbicides
Hardness minerals responsible for scale buildup
Unpleasant odors, tastes, and cloudiness
